Whitefish, Montana, is a picturesque town known for its stunning natural surroundings and outdoor recreational opportunities. The weather in Whitefish varies significantly throughout the year, offering distinct experiences in each season. Winter, from December to February, transforms Whitefish into a winter wonderland, with average temperatures ranging from 17°F to 30°F. This season is characterized by heavy snowfall, making it a prime destination for skiing and snowboarding enthusiasts. Whitefish Mountain Resort is particularly popular during this time. Despite the cold, the snow-covered landscapes are breathtaking, and the town has a cozy, festive atmosphere. Spring, from March to May, brings a gradual warming trend with temperatures ranging from 25°F to 60°F. This season can be unpredictable, with lingering snow showers in early spring giving way to rain as the season progresses. The melting snow and rain can make for muddy conditions, but the emerging wildflowers and greenery are a beautiful sight. Summer, from June to August, offers the most pleasant weather, with average temperatures ranging from 45°F to 80°F. This is the peak season for visitors, as the warm and generally dry conditions are ideal for hiking, fishing, boating, and exploring Glacier National Park. The long daylight hours provide ample time for adventure, and the town buzzes with activity. Autumn, from September to November, sees temperatures cool from 45°F to 25°F. The fall foliage in the surrounding forests and mountains is spectacular, with vibrant colors painting the landscape. This is a quieter season for tourism, but it's a favorite for those who enjoy the crisp air and fewer crowds. Precipitation increases as winter approaches, with snowfall becoming more common towards the end of the season. The most popular weather conditions in Whitefish are found in the summer months, when the climate is warm and conducive to a wide range of outdoor activities. However, for those who relish winter sports, the snowy months are equally appealing. For a balance of pleasant weather and natural beauty, late spring and early autumn are excellent times to visit, offering milder temperatures and the chance to witness the seasonal transitions.
Whitefish, Montana, nestled at the edge of Glacier National Park, offers a unique blend of cultural experiences amidst its stunning natural backdrop. This charming mountain town is a haven for travelers seeking to immerse themselves in the arts, history, and local customs, all while being surrounded by the breathtaking landscapes of the Northern Rockies. Begin your cultural journey at the Whitefish Theatre Company, where the local community comes together to celebrate the performing arts. This vibrant hub offers a variety of live performances, from plays and musicals to concerts and dance shows, showcasing both local talent and touring acts. Art enthusiasts will find solace in the array of galleries that dot the town. The Whitefish Gallery Nights, a summer event, transforms the town into a festive art walk where visitors can explore local galleries, meet artists, and enjoy live music. The Dick Idol Signature Gallery, for instance, features Western art and sculptures, while the Going to the Sun Gallery offers a diverse collection of works by Montana artists. History buffs can delve into the region's past at the Stumptown Historical Society, located in the historic Whitefish Depot. This museum provides a glimpse into the early days of the town, the Great Northern Railway, and the logging industry that shaped the region. The depot itself is a beautifully preserved piece of history, and the museum's exhibits tell the story of Whitefish's evolution from a railroad town to a ski and summer resort. Local customs are best experienced during Whitefish's vibrant events and festivals. The Whitefish Winter Carnival, a tradition since 1960, celebrates the season with a parade, ski races, and a royal court. In the summer, the Huckleberry Days Arts Festival honors the beloved local berry with over 100 artists and craftsmen, food vendors, and live entertainment. For a taste of the local music scene, the Great Northern Bar & Grill is a staple, offering live music and a lively atmosphere. The town also hosts the annual Under the Big Sky Music Festival, which features a lineup of renowned country, folk, and Americana artists. Whitefish's culinary scene complements its cultural offerings, with an emphasis on farm-to-table dining and local brews. Sample regional specialties at the town's many restaurants, or visit the local farmers market to taste the freshest produce and artisanal products. In Whitefish, the combination of cultural richness and natural beauty creates an unforgettable experience for those who seek to connect with the arts, history, and local traditions in a serene mountain setting.

Whitefish, Montana, is a charming mountain town that serves as a gateway to the natural wonders of the Flathead Valley and Glacier National Park. This picturesque destination is accessible by a variety of transportation options, catering to the needs of outdoor enthusiasts and those seeking a tranquil retreat. For those arriving by air, Glacier Park International Airport is the nearest airport, located just a short drive away in Kalispell. It offers flights from several major airlines, connecting travelers to and from hubs across the United States. From the airport, rental cars, taxis, and shuttle services are available to transport visitors to Whitefish. Whitefish is also a stop on Amtrak's Empire Builder route, which traverses the northern United States from Chicago to Seattle/Portland. The train station is conveniently located in the heart of downtown Whitefish, making it an attractive option for those who prefer a scenic journey by rail. Once in Whitefish, getting around can be a delightful experience. The town itself is quite walkable, with a compact downtown area that features a variety of shops, restaurants, and galleries. Many visitors enjoy strolling through the streets, soaking up the small-town atmosphere and mountain scenery. For those looking to explore the surrounding areas, such as Whitefish Mountain Resort or Glacier National Park, a car is the most convenient option. Car rentals are available in town and at the airport, providing the flexibility to venture out into the vast landscapes that make this region famous. During the ski season, the SNOW bus offers free transportation between Whitefish and the ski resort, making it easy for visitors to hit the slopes without the need for a vehicle. Cycling is another popular mode of transportation in Whitefish, especially during the warmer months. The area boasts numerous bike trails, and bike rentals are available for those who wish to explore on two wheels. In summary, Whitefish offers a range of transportation options suitable for both arrival and local travel. The town's walkability, combined with easy access to rental cars and public transportation, ensures that visitors can navigate the area with ease and fully enjoy the natural beauty and recreational opportunities that Whitefish has to offer.
